Uncle’s Commuted Sentence Under Fire

A chilling case unfolds as two men face serious charges in the death of a 14-year-old girl found in rural South Dakota — her uncle, recently freed by Governor Kristi Noem after a 30-year sentence, now faces drug-related manslaughter charges, while his alleged accomplice is accused of conspiracy and cover-up. The FBI calls it one of the most tragic investigations they’ve handled, especially involving a child. The commutation documents remain sealed, and Noem, who’s now advising a Canadian mining firm, hasn’t spoken out.
